If developing, you'll want both 'Task::Catalyst' and 'Catalyst::Devel' from CPAN.
Working within the framework is a little different to writing your own code and certainly to start with feels odd. But if you invest the time to learn how not to fight it, you'll get the benefit of pre-written (and debugged!) authentication modules etc.
In reply to Re: Basics: CGI MySQL security
by jbert
in thread Basics: CGI MySQL security
by jfrm
| For: | Use: | ||
| & | & | ||
| < | < | ||
| > | > | ||
| [ | [ | ||
| ] | ] |